Key Players in the Industrial IoT Data Diodes market:

Owl Cyber Defense (Incl. Tresys), Fox-IT, Waterfall Security Solutions, Advenica, BAE Systems, Genua, Belden (Hirschmann), Fibersystem, Deep Secure, VADO Security Technologies Ltd., Infodas, ST Engineering (Digisafe), Nexor, Siemens, PA Consulting, Arbit, Garland Technology, Rovenma, Toecsec
